The Bride of Messina (Czech: Nevěsta messinská) is a tragic opera in three acts, op.
The Czech language libretto by Otakar Hostinský is based on Friedrich Schiller's play Die Braut von Messina.
At its first presentation music critics responded with high praise to the work and it is now considered to be Fibich's masterpiece.
However, the opera's morose story, melancholy scoring and astringent style have hindered it from gaining wide popularity.
